Reaction

The recombinant enzyme hydrolyses proteins (serum albumin, collagen) and synthetic substrates (Z-Phe-Arg-NHMec > Z-Leu-Arg-NHMec > Z-Val-Arg-NHMec) =

Synonyms

cathepsin L2, cathepsin L2/V, cathepsin like 2, cathepsin U, cathepsin V, cathepsin V/L2, cathepsin-V, CatV, CL2, CTSL2, CTSV, CV/L2, hcatV, More, stratum corneum thiol protease
